Skip to content

【PFCC-Roadmap】算子数据类型扩展 #42699

@jeff41404

Description

@jeff41404

Roadmap

飞桨现有算子已经能较完整地支持float32、float64、int32、int64、bool等常用数据类型,同时部分算子也支持 complex64、complex128、fp16、bf16、int8 等数据类型,我们希望进一步扩大支持后面这些数据类型的算子范围,让飞桨能支持更多应用场景的需求。本方向主要开发:和飞桨专家一起扩展现有算子的功能,开发支持complex64、complex128、fp16、bf16、int8 等数据类型,并解决制约这些数据类型支持的基础问题。

  1. 支持复数数据类型(complex64、complex128)。需要支持复数类型的算子可参考 石墨表格《PFCC-Roadmap》之【算子数据类型扩展-复数】
  2. 支持 fp16数据类型。fp16全称Half-precision floating-point,需要支持fp16数据类型的算子可参考(整理中)
  3. 支持 bf16数据类型。bf16全称bfloat16 floating-point,需要支持bf16数据类型的算子可参考(整理中)

Metadata

Metadata

Assignees

No one assigned

    Labels

    PFCCPaddle Framework Contributor Club,https://github.com/PaddlePaddle/community/tree/master/pfcc

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ions